English
Etymology
From small + fortune (“one’s wealth; the amount of money one has, especially if it is vast; large amount of money”), suggesting a sizeable sum of money but not all of one’s wealth.
Pronunciation
Noun
small fortune (plural small fortunes)
- (colloquial, hyperbolic) A large amount of money, especially one paid for something.
- Synonyms: bundle, (both informal) mint, (slang) pile
Divorcing my wife cost me a small fortune.
